About Mahesh Kumar Singh
Mahesh Kumar Singh is a scholar working on Geochemistry and Petrology, General Energy and Soil Science, having authored 90 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metal complexes synthesis and properties (13 papers), Organometallic Compounds Synthesis and Characterization (8 papers) and Inorganic and Organometallic Chemistry (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Geochemistry and Petrology (209 citations), Water Science and Technology (198 citations) and Environmental Engineering (139 citations). Mahesh Kumar Singh has collaborated with scholars based in India, Hungary and United States. Frequent co-authors include K. Brindha, Mou Leong Tan, Bikash Debnath, Debasish Maiti, Sanchari Goswami, Manik Das, Kuntal Manna, Waikhom Somraj Singh, Ram A. Lal and G. Gowrisankar.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The Science of The Total Environment and Tetrahedron.
